The HD maps market size is projected to grow from USD 1.34 billion in 2026 to USD 2.43 billion by 2033, at a CAGR of 8.9%. The HD maps market is shifting toward multi program map platforms that allow OEMs to reuse map data, localization, and update infrastructure across vehicle models and regions, reducing duplicated validation and maintenance costs. The expansion of Level 2+, Level 3, and Level 4 driving functions in passenger cars and commercial vehicles is increasing demand for lane level road geometry, road boundaries, traffic controls, and regularly updated map data. Advances in automated map generation, sensor based change detection, 3D mapping, and OTA updates are also making it easier to maintain HD maps across larger road networks.

The HD maps market is being shaped by the growing importance of map quality, standardization, and interoperability across autonomous driving systems. OEMs and Tier 1 suppliers are focusing on standardized map formats and data structures that allow HD maps to integrate smoothly with localization, perception, and vehicle computing platforms. Standards such as ADASIS are supporting this interoperability by defining interfaces for transferring map data to vehicle systems. At the same time, centimeter-level accuracy and validation of lane geometry, road boundaries, and traffic attributes are becoming increasingly important to meet the reliability requirements of higher automation. This is creating demand for HD map providers with strong quality assurance, standardized data models, and compatibility across different vehicle architectures.

Driver: Increased Demand from OEMs for Continuously Refreshed Rather Than Static HD Maps

OEMs are moving toward HD maps that can be updated more frequently as road layouts, lane configurations, speed limits, and road restrictions change. Static map databases can become outdated between update cycles, creating limitations for higher levels of automated driving. This is increasing demand for map solutions that combine vehicle and infrastructure data with automated change detection and cloud based processing to deliver updated road information to vehicles.

Restraint: High Cost of Creating and Maintaining Lane Level Map Coverage

Creating lane-level HD maps across large road networks requires high volumes of vehicle sensor data, precise positioning, mapping equipment, data processing, and continuous validation. Maintaining this coverage is also costly because road geometry and traffic attributes change frequently. These costs can limit expansion into lower-density markets and make it difficult for providers to maintain consistent map quality across large geographic areas.

Opportunity: Vehicle Generated Data and Maps as a Service Enabling Scalable HD Map Creation and Continuous Updates

Vehicle-generated data is enabling map providers to use sensor observations from connected vehicles to identify changes in road geometry, lane markings, traffic signs, and other road attributes. Combined with Maps as a Service models, this can reduce dependence on dedicated mapping campaigns and support continuous map updates. OEMs and Tier 1 suppliers can also use these services to access updated map content without maintaining separate mapping infrastructure, creating opportunities for recurring HD map and localization services.

Challenge: Complex Real-time Merging of Multi-sensor Data

Autonomous vehicles depend on cameras, LiDAR, radar, and ultrasonic sensors, each offering unique inputs that must be fused in real time. Achieving precise synchronization and aligning sensor data with HD maps is technically challenging, especially with road changes or temporary obstacles. Any delay or mismatch reduces localization accuracy and safety. Companies such as Mobileye use crowd-sourced vision data to update maps, but real-time harmonization of massive, diverse sensor streams remains a key hurdle. Overcoming this demands advanced AI, edge computing, and extensive real-world testing.

MARKET ECOSYSTEM

The HD maps market ecosystem is moving from a traditional map supply chain toward an integrated data and technology ecosystem. HD map providers develop lane level road data, 3D road models, localization layers, and map update solutions, while mapping and geospatial companies support data collection, annotation, validation, and map production. OEMs and Tier 1 suppliers integrate HD maps with ADAS, autonomous driving software, sensor fusion, vehicle computing, and navigation systems to support higher levels of automation. Sensor, positioning, and connectivity providers contribute LiDAR, radar, GNSS, V2X, and vehicle generated data to improve map creation and localization accuracy. Cloud and data platform providers support map processing, storage, updates, and distribution. Partnerships across these stakeholders are helping improve map accuracy, update frequency, and integration into passenger car and commercial vehicle platforms.

REGION

Asia Pacific is expected to be the largest HD maps market for autonomous vehicles

In Asia Pacific, the HD maps market is supported by the rapid expansion of advanced driver assistance, automated driving programs, and high-precision mapping capabilities across China, Japan, and South Korea. OEMs and technology companies in the region are focusing on integrating HD maps with localization, sensor fusion, and automated driving systems, while map providers are expanding lane-level and 3D road coverage to support these applications. The region is also becoming a strong base for automated map generation and high-frequency map updates, supported by large vehicle fleets and extensive road networks that provide substantial vehicle and road data. For instance, Hyundai Motor Group's Pleos Connect targets map-based services across Hyundai, Kia, and Genesis vehicles, while Baidu Apollo combines HD maps with autonomous driving software and vehicle sensor data to support automated driving applications in China. OEM investments in high-precision localization, automated map generation, and connected mapping platforms are creating opportunities for HD map providers to support large-scale deployment of automated driving functions and frequently updated lane-level and 3D map services.

RECENT DEVELOPMENTS

  • April 2026 : HERE Technologies has strengthened its collaboration with Chinese intelligent driving company neueHCT to enhance the global expansion of Navigation on Autopilot (NOA) solutions. This partnership aims to integrate HERE’s mapping and location technology with neueHCT’s intelligent driving stack to support advanced assisted and automated driving features for global OEMs.
  • April 2026 : HERE Technologies and Baidu Maps have signed a strategic memorandum of understanding to co-develop seamless global navigation and intelligent driving map solutions for automakers. This collaboration aims to integrate HERE’s global coverage with Baidu’s China maps to enhance advanced in-vehicle navigation and intelligent driving use cases worldwide.
  • April 2026 : Waymo commenced testing autonomous vehicles in downtown Chicago, mapping city streets and assessing performance in winter weather for the first time. This activity expands Waymo’s HD map coverage and validates its mapping and perception stack under snow and cold-weather conditions.
  • March 2026 : DennoKotsu chose Mapbox to upgrade its taxi dispatch platform in Japan, leveraging Mapbox’s mapping and navigation technologies to enhance driver routing, passenger pickup, and operational efficiency. This partnership expands Mapbox’s presence in in-vehicle and fleet navigation, relevant for future autonomous mobility services.
  • February 2026 : NVIDIA Partnered with Delhivery to develop digital mapping solutions designed for India’s complex geography and informal addressing systems. The solution uses NVIDIA’s accelerated computing, CV Cuda, and Nemotron open models, combined with Delhivery’s proprietary dataset covering billions of shipments.
  • February 2026 : Mapbox introduced doorway-level accuracy capabilities across its platform, enhancing Mapbox 3D Lanes with precise positioning for delivery, logistics, and ride-hailing. This improved accuracy supports advanced driver assistance and autonomous driving navigation use cases.
  • January 2026 : TomTom and Visteon announced a partnership to integrate TomTom’s maps and navigation with Visteon’s in-car systems. This collaboration aims to deliver a privacy-focused, onboard conversational navigation experience, showcasing embedded, AI-driven navigation for automated and autonomous vehicles.
  • January 2026 : CE Info Systems Ltd., the parent company of MapmyIndia, acquired 3,500 compulsorily convertible preference shares in indoor navigation startup Iwayplus Private Limited for USD 0.21 million. This acquisition enhances CE Info Systems’ location and navigation technology, potentially supporting future HD mapping and autonomous mobility solutions.
  • January 2026 : Mobileye acquired AI robotics startup Mentee Robotics for about USD 900 million to accelerate the development of physical AI across autonomous driving and humanoid robotics. This acquisition aims to enhance Mobileye’s perception, planning, and simulation capabilities, which also support REM-based HD mapping for automated vehicles.

Market Definition

HD maps are ultra-precise digital maps with centimeter-level accuracy, specifically developed for autonomous driving. They capture detailed road geometry, lane-level information, traffic signs, barriers, and 3D features of the environment. These maps enable vehicles to localize their exact position beyond GPS accuracy and plan complex driving actions safely. They are a critical layer of perception for self-driving systems.

ADAS maps are enhanced navigation maps designed to support driver-assistance features rather than full autonomy. They provide attributes such as road curvature, gradient, lane count, speed limits, and upcoming traffic conditions. These maps work in combination with sensors to improve functions such as adaptive cruise control, lane-keeping assist, and predictive powertrain control. Their role is to extend safety, comfort, and efficiency for human-driven vehicles.
